Federal law is meant to forbid it, and even California Gov. Gavin Newsom calls it unfair.

Yet on Saturday, AB Hernandez, a boy, swept the girls’ high leap, triple leap and long leap on the California Interscholastic Federation Southern Sectionals competitors.

Hernandez’s dominating distances will probably advance him to the state championships on the finish of the month. 

CIF allowed the first-place lady in every occasion to share the rostrum with Hernandez — tacitly admitting two plain information: that Hernadez is male, and that younger girls have unfairly needed to compete in opposition to him for years.

The record of displaced girls is so long at this level that we’ve stopped flinching.

High jumper Reese Hogan is one of them; she’s been pressured off the podium’s prime spot by Hernandez time and again again. 

“It’s just really disappointing to go into a competition knowing you already lost,” Hogan has stated.

Everyone is aware of women and men are totally different. 

Everyone is aware of girls’s sports exist as a result of males are, on average, quicker, stronger and possess larger bodily benefits in almost each athletic area. 

Those are easy truths — however the reality is we’re not but successful.

We’ve had main successes: In 2025, President Donald Trump’s govt order directed federal businesses to guard girls’s sports by recognizing organic intercourse.

The International Olympic Committee has introduced new guidelines safeguarding girls’s occasions on the 2028 Los Angeles Games.

Many states, 27 presently, now have protecting legal guidelines.

Polls show roughly 80% of Americans consider the ladies’s class needs to be for girls solely. 

But regardless of this actuality, 23 states nonetheless enable gender id to override organic intercourse.

Boys proceed to take titles, scholarships, information and alternatives from feminine athletes.

California’s Hernandez is only one instance; it’s occurring in swimming pools, on tracks and on fields nationwide. 

And the silent majority bears accountability.

Brave girls are left to forfeit competitions, communicate out in school board conferences and file lawsuits, whereas the 80% who agree with them stand by mute.

Children are carrying a burden adults ought to shoulder — however received’t.

Why? Fear of the bullying 20%.

The upcoming Supreme Court determination in Little v. Hecox, anticipated in June, will likely be telling. 

A ruling for organic actuality would merely enable the 27 protecting states to implement their legal guidelines; it received’t power the opposite 23 to change.

A “win” received’t signal progress — it would simply imply we received’t slip backward.

For Reese Hogan, who should nonetheless compete in opposition to Hernandez, nothing will change.

So the fight is much from over.

Yes, all 50 states need legal guidelines defending girls’s sports.

Here in Colorado, I’m chairing a  grassroots poll initiative to do exactly that. 

But legal protections, whereas important, aren’t enough: We should additionally change the tradition.

Currently, persistently, our establishments — the media, universities and company America — are each occupied by and beholden to the 20% .  

Watch, for instance, who the media chooses to humanize.

The Los Angeles Times gave a sympathetic platform to Hernandez’s mom, a mother or father decided to keep her male little one competing in opposition to girls.

It hasn’t profiled Reese Hogan, or the opposite feminine athletes displaced for years. 

That’s an editorial alternative — one which creates the phantasm of a societal consensus that doesn’t exist.  

Nike reportedly imposes contract provisions on its star feminine athletes, barring them from talking out in regards to the safety of girls’s sports.  

Officers and coaches at universities instruct feminine athletes to not publicly defend their own sports; some who wished to affix our crew at XX-XY Athletics have needed to bow out as a result of of it.  

Advocates for the US Olympic and Paralympic Committee threaten athletes that in the event that they do communicate up, they’ll risk their standing within the Olympic motion.

That’s how entrenched transgender ideology has develop into.  

When the establishments constructed to guard athletes quietly punish those who dissent, the issue isn’t the law; it’s the tradition.

The 20% is fully comfy working roughshod over girls who dare to stand of their own protection.

Culture solely adjustments when the strain to change lastly outweighs the consolation of doing nothing. 

And girls’s sports are price saving.

They characterize alternative, equity and the popularity that sex-based variations matter.

Teenage girls, who know the stakes higher than anybody, have proven extraordinary braveness — however we will’t keep putting the burden on them.

The grown-ups who’ve submitted to being bullied into silence should screw up their braveness and be a part of them.

Jennifer Sey is founder and CEO of XX-XY Athletics.
